Infrared Nanosecond Fiber Laser Market Size

The global Infrared Nanosecond Fiber Laser market was valued at US$ 335 million in 2025 and is anticipated to reach US$ 494 million by 2032, at a CAGR of 5.7% from 2026 to 2032.

In 2025, the global production of infrared nanosecond fiber lasers was approximately 22,800 units, with an average selling price of about US$14,700 per unit. The production capacity of a single line is approximately 800-2000 units per year, with an average gross profit margin of about 20-30%. An infrared nanosecond fiber laser is a laser device with an output wavelength in the infrared band (typically 1064nm) and a nanosecond pulse width (10⁻⁹ seconds). It uses optical fiber as the gain medium and transmission medium, generating and amplifying laser light through stimulated emission, and then outputting high-power nanosecond pulses through pulse modulation technology.
The core of the upstream supply chain for infrared nanosecond fiber lasers lies in providing key raw materials and core components, mainly including semiconductor laser pump sources, special optical fibers, fiber Bragg gratings and other optical devices, as well as chips and electronic components used in control systems. Downstream, it is deeply integrated into the high-end equipment manufacturing field, widely used in terminal industries such as material processing, consumer electronics manufacturing, and medical device manufacturing, directly serving system integrators and end manufacturers in these industries.
Infrared nanosecond fiber lasers are widely used in material processing, laser marking, laser welding, laser engraving, and scientific research due to their high efficiency, high stability, and superior beam quality. With the increasing demand for high-precision and high-efficiency processing in the manufacturing industry, the market demand for infrared nanosecond fiber lasers is growing year by year. Especially in the electronics, automotive, aerospace, and medical industries, nanosecond lasers have become important industrial equipment because of their ability to precisely process various materials such as metals, ceramics, and plastics.
In recent years, the technology of infrared nanosecond fiber lasers has continuously advanced, particularly in innovations in fiber laser sources, laser power, and wavelength control. These advancements have led to significant improvements in power, stability, and size, adapting to a wider range of application needs. Furthermore, the high efficiency and low maintenance costs of fiber lasers make them the preferred choice for many companies, increasing market demand for this type of laser.
In the global market, the Asia-Pacific region, especially China and India, is the largest market for infrared nanosecond fiber lasers due to its rapidly developing manufacturing industry. North America and Europe are also actively promoting the application of this technology, particularly in the automotive and aerospace sectors. In the future, the global market for infrared nanosecond fiber lasers will continue to grow, driven by factors such as automated manufacturing, intelligent manufacturing, and the demand for high-quality processing technologies.
